A Yoga session includes:

  • Greetings and Introduction
  • Warm Up and/or Story
  • Themed Standing Yoga Sequence
  • Balance Practice or Partner Yoga practice
  • Yoga Game
  • Meditation or breathing short practice
  • Wind Down Sequence
  • Lying Down Relaxation

8 Things Parents Should Know About Children's Yoga

  • Yoga boosts Physical and Emotional Development in children
  • Yoga improves concentration which helps learning
  • Yoga fosters physical balance which is key to mental balance
  • Yoga shows the interconnection of body and mind through the breath so children can start being more aware of their emotions and how to control them
  • Children Yoga focuses on respect of others and understanding of how our actions affects others
  • Yoga encourages creativity through personal expression, story telling and drama skills
  • Yoga is a skill for life, and can help children look for resources and solutions within themselves
  • Yoga is fun whilst offering a way to experience a tranquil state of alertness
